HSBC will expand 皇冠体育app presence
(皇冠体育app Daily/Agencies)
Updated: 2009-11-09 07:46 HSBC Holdings is preparing to boost its 皇冠体育app presence about 20 percent next year, as it ramps up for an IPO in one of its fastest growing markets, a top company executive said. The Europe's biggest bank wants to open 15 to 20 new branches in 皇冠体育app next year pending regulatory approval, up from the 90 to 100 it will have at the end of this year, Sandy Flockhart, HSBC's Asia chief executive, said. "We will be the largest international bank in 皇冠体育app, and we will continue to invest in 皇冠体育app in 2010," he said. HSBC has been among the more active foreign banks in 皇冠体育app, where it earned a pre-tax profit of $752 million in the first half of the year, accounting for about 15 percent of the company's total. It competes here with the likes of Citigroup and Standard Chartered. In addition to its own branch network, HSBC's 皇冠体育app investments also include a 19 percent stake in Bank of Communications, a 16.8 percent stake in Ping An Insurance and a 12 percent stake in 皇冠体育app's Industrial Bank. HSBC said recently it would go to a dual-headquarters system in Hong Kong and London to emphasize the importance the bank places on Asia. Last month, the bank said it was swinging its power base back to its place of birth 144 years ago by moving its chief executive to Hong Kong. Flockhart said his bank, which posted a 50 percent drop in first-half profits, will focus its Asia acquisition strategy on 皇冠体育app and other emerging markets as it increasingly relies on the region for growth. To underscore the importance of 皇冠体育app to its future, HSBC has become one of a handful of foreign companies to announce its intent to list in 皇冠体育app when the country announces rules for such listings later this year or in early 2010. Hong Kong's Bank of East Asia has said it would like to make such a listing.
HSBC's planned 皇冠体育app IPO is subject to regulatory requirements, and there is no specific time frame yet, Flockhart said. HSBC could raise as much as 50 billion yuan in a Shanghai listing as soon as next year as it vies to become one of the first foreign companies to list in 皇冠体育app, people familiar with the matter said in August. The bank has hired 皇冠体育app International Capital Corp (CICC) and CITIC Securities Co to help arrange an IPO in Shanghai, a person with direct knowledge of the situation said. The Shanghai flotation is a way to accelerate the bank's growth on the mainland at a time when international rivals have retreated, the company has said. HSBC Holdings said in August its first-half profit halved to $5 billion as it was hit by rising bad debts in the United States, Europe and Asia.
